> My second wish is to be able to implement something like tabstops in a > word processor with respect to labeling titles. For instance: > > 1. Title 1 > 2. Title 2 > ... > 10. Title 3 > > So there would be a tab stop after the label (in this case, the > numbering) at the 'T' in "Title" for each element. I thought this kind > of functionality might be implemented by a fo:leader, but I'm not > certain. Could any FO experts toss me a clue? It can be done with leaders but would rely on a hack using use-content for leader pattern (the leader will hold the Title's label, not go after it); it is probably not what you want if you want compability among procesors, or predictability at least. Another approach would be to use a list for each title; it is the simplest way to display two inlines aligned vertically with fixed horizontal offsets. <list-block> <list-item provisional-label-separation="1em" provisional-distance-between-starts="8em"> <list-item-label end-indent="label-end()"> <para>1.</para> </list-item-label> <list-item-body start-indent="body-start()"> <para>Title 1</para> </list-item-body> </list-item> </list-block> I hope I haven't made too much typing errors in the code.
